New Research Survey Aims to Capture Non-Profit Sector Key Challenges & Shape Future Support Programs

Announcement posted by Telco Together Foundation 03 Mar 2015

The Telco Together Foundation today launched a new research survey to capture a meaningful view of the common issues and challenges faced by the non-profit sector of Australia.

Telco Together is calling on all staff, management and volunteers working for a charitable or non-profit organisation, to please help by completing the simple online Charity Insights Survey, which involves a time commitment of between five – 15 minutes, depending on the complexity of the story or challenge being shared. Insights gained through this research will be analysed using an innovative and cutting-edge research tool, SenseMaker. Key findings from the survey will help define future Telco Together funded strategic community programs that support Australian charities. 

“We are seeking input from charities Australia-wide, across an extensive range of causes and challenges, to help us identify key patterns and trends,” said Maria Simonelli, Programs Manager at Telco Together Foundation.

“Many of us working in the non-profit sector will likely have more than one challenge in our daily working lives, so this research tool allows for individuals to take the survey multiple times, sharing a different challenge each time the survey is completed. 

“By taking the survey, you will be helping Telco Together obtain greater insight and understanding of the challenges you face on a daily basis. Insights gained will then be used to help inform future strategic programs that support the non-profit sector, which will be of direct benefit to Australian charities,” said Ms Simonelli.

The online tool being used to conduct this research – SenseMaker - works like a short survey, asking participants to share a story about a time when they needed help at work, followed by a series of brief exploratory questions. Each individual’s input to the survey is anonymous, and key results will be made available to participants in future.

This nation-wide survey is kindly being supported by Volunteering Victoria , Volunteering Queensland and Volunteering ACT, who will be distributing the survey to thousands of Australian charities they support and work with throughout the year.

About Telco Together Foundation
Launched in July 2012, Telco Together Foundation is a registered charity that brings together the telecommunications industry in support of Australian communities in need across areas including Indigenous communities, the homeless, mental health and refugees.

The core focus of the Foundation’s work is the development of community projects that build on the technology, reach and capabilities of the telecommunications industry to support the not for profit sector of Australia, as well as promoting fundraising, volunteering and workplace giving across member organisations.  

Members of the Foundation include Telstra, Optus, Vodafone, NBN Co, M2, iiNet, Cisco, Alcatel-Lucent and 16 other ICT organisations. The Foundation is governed by an Advisory Board that has Executive Officer level representation from members.
